The Role of Robotics in Cold Storage and Temperature-Controlled Warehouses

Cold storage and temperature-controlled warehouses play a critical role in preserving perishable goods such as food, pharmaceuticals, and biomedical supplies. However, maintaining efficiency in sub-zero environments presents challenges, including high energy costs, labor shortages, and product integrity risks.

Robotic automation is transforming cold storage operations, enhancing efficiency, accuracy, and safety while minimizing human exposure to extreme temperatures.

2. How Robotics Enhances Cold Storage Efficiency

Robots in temperature-controlled warehouses optimize storage, picking, and transportation while reducing energy consumption.

1. Autonomous Mobile Robots (AMRs) for Inventory Transport

AMRs navigate warehouse floors autonomously, transporting goods without human intervention.

Example:

Ocado, a grocery fulfillment giant, uses AMRs in its automated warehouses to streamline cold storage logistics.

2. Automated Storage and Retrieval Systems (ASRS)

ASRS robots optimize warehouse space and enable high-density storage in cold environments.

Example:

Lineage Logistics employs ASRS technology to improve space utilization and reduce energy costs in frozen food warehouses.

3. Robotic Picking Arms for Precision Handling

AI-powered robotic arms enhance order fulfillment speed and accuracy in frozen environments.

Example:

Amazon Fresh utilizes robotic arms for frozen food order picking, improving order accuracy.

3. Robotics and AI in Cold Chain Logistics

Cold chain logistics rely on robotics and AI for real-time monitoring and efficient distribution.

1. AI-Powered Temperature Monitoring

AI-driven sensors ensure constant temperature control for perishable goods.

Example:

Pharmaceutical companies use AI-powered monitoring systems to maintain proper vaccine storage conditions.

2. Robotic Drones for Inventory Audits

AI-driven drones conduct inventory audits in cold storage warehouses.

Example:

Walmart uses robotic drones for automated stock audits in its temperature-controlled warehouses.
